Resolution 1481RESOLUTION NO. 1481 A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F EDMONDS, WASHINGTON, DENYING A PROPOSED PRIVATELY INITIATED CODE AMENDMENT TO ECDC SECTION 20.75.045.11, ENTITLED "UNIT LOT SUBDIVISION — APPLICABILITY". WHEREAS, this application was introduced to Council on May 4, 2021; and WHEREAS, the public hearing on the request was opened on July 27 and continued to August 17, 2021; and WHEREAS, a private developer, represented by Citizen Design Collaborative, has proposed to add the Downtown Business zones to the areas in Edmonds where the unit lot subdivision process can be used; and WHEREAS, unit lot subdivisions are currently only allowed in the General Commercial, Multiple Residential, and Westgate Mixed Use zones; and WHEREAS, while this change would apply to all the Downtown Business (BD) subdistricts, the developer would like to use the process at the site of his anticipated 14 -unit townhome project at 614/616 5th Avenue South; and WHEREAS, this proposal is a Type V action that resides within the city council's legislative discretion; and WHEREAS, the city council expressed concern that this type of ownership structure could lead to the use of fewer ground floor retail spaces than would be used under condominium or single building ownership; and WHEREAS, the city council preliminarily voted on August 17, 2021 to deny the proposal; now therefore, TH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F EDMONDS, WASHINGTON, HEREBY RESOLVES AS FOLLOWS: Section 1. The city council hereby denies the text amendment application submitted under file number AMD2020-0003. RESOLVED this 24th day of August, 2021.
